Who is a Psychiatrist?
A psychiatrist is a medical doctor (MBBS) who has completed specialized training in psychiatry. Unlike many other mental health professionals, psychiatrists can:
- Diagnose mental illnesses
- Prescribe medications
- Conduct comprehensive psychiatric evaluations
- Recommend psychotherapy
- Coordinate treatment with psychologists and therapists
- Manage complex psychiatric conditions
Because psychiatrists understand both physical and psychological health, they evaluate how medical conditions, genetics, and lifestyle factors contribute to mental illness.
When Should You Visit a Psychiatrist?
Many people wait too long before seeking help. If emotional difficulties begin affecting your personal, social, or professional life, it's worth consulting a psychiatrist.
Common reasons include:
Persistent Anxiety
If worry feels constant and begins interfering with work, sleep, or relationships, professional evaluation can help identify anxiety disorders and appropriate treatment options.
Depression
Feeling sad for weeks, losing interest in activities, or struggling with motivation may indicate clinical depression.
Symptoms may include:
- Low mood
- Fatigue
- Loss of interest
- Appetite changes
- Sleep disturbances
- Hopelessness
Panic Attacks
Sudden episodes involving:
- Rapid heartbeat
- Sweating
- Breathlessness
- Chest tightness
- Fear of losing control
can often be effectively treated with psychiatric care.
Sleep Problems
Difficulty sleeping may sometimes be linked to:
- Anxiety
- Depression
- Stress disorders
- Mood disorders
Rather than treating insomnia alone, psychiatrists identify the underlying cause.
Mood Swings
Frequent emotional highs and lows, irritability, or sudden behavioral changes may require professional assessment.
Obsessive Thoughts
Repeated intrusive thoughts and compulsive behaviors could indicate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D).
Trauma
Individuals who have experienced:
- Accidents
- Abuse
- Violence
- Natural disasters
- Emotional trauma
may benefit from psychiatric evaluation and trauma-focused treatment.
ADHD
Adults and children experiencing concentration difficulties, impulsivity, or organizational challenges can receive proper assessments and treatment recommendations.
Addiction
Psychiatrists also assist individuals dealing with:
- Alcohol dependence
- Drug addiction
- Prescription medication misuse
- Behavioral addictions

What Happens During Your First Appointment?
Many people feel nervous before their first consultation.
Typically, the psychiatrist will discuss:
- Your current symptoms
- Medical history
- Family history
- Lifestyle
- Stressors
- Sleep patterns
- Physical health
- Current medications
The consultation is confidential and focused on understanding your concerns without judgment. Based on the evaluation, the psychiatrist develops a personalized treatment plan.
Treatment Options Offered
Psychiatric treatment isn't limited to medication.
Treatment plans may include:
Medication Management
Certain conditions respond well to carefully prescribed medications.
Examples include:
- Antidepressants
- Anti-anxiety medications
- Mood stabilizers
- Antipsychotics
- ADHD medications
Medication decisions are based on careful evaluation and ongoing monitoring.
Psychotherapy
Many psychiatrists either provide therapy themselves or collaborate with psychologists.
Evidence-based therapies include:
-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T)
- Interpersonal Therapy
- Mindfulness-Based Therapy
- Supportive Therapy
Lifestyle Recommendations
Recovery often involves:
- Better sleep habits
- Exercise
- Nutrition
- Stress management
- Relaxation techniques
Family Education
Mental illness affects families too.
Psychiatrists often educate caregivers about:
- Understanding symptoms
- Supporting recovery
- Improving communication
- Preventing relapse
Difference Between a Psychiatrist and a Psychologist
Many people confuse these professions.
| Psychiatrist | Psychologist |
|---|---|
| Medical doctor | Mental health professional |
| Can prescribe medication | Cannot prescribe medication (in most settings) |
| Diagnoses mental illness | Conducts psychological assessments |
| Manages medical treatment | Provides psychotherapy |
| Treats complex psychiatric conditions | Focuses on behavioral interventions |
Often, psychiatrists and psychologists work together for comprehensive care.

Tips Before Your First Consultation
To make your appointment more productive:
- Write down your symptoms.
- Note when symptoms began.
- List current medications.
- Mention previous treatments.
- Bring relevant medical records.
- Be honest about alcohol or substance use.
- Prepare questions for your psychiatrist.
Remember that the consultation is a collaborative process designed to understand your needs.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is visiting a psychiatrist only for severe mental illness?
No. Psychiatrists help with a wide range of concerns, from stress and anxiety to complex psychiatric conditions.
Will I always need medication?
Not necessarily. Treatment depends on your diagnosis and individual needs. Some people benefit from therapy alone, while others may require medication or a combination of both.
Are online consultations effective?
Yes. For many conditions, online psychiatric consultations provide effective, convenient, and confidential access to care when clinically appropriate.
How long does treatment last?
Treatment duration varies depending on the condition, symptom severity, and individual response. Some people improve within months, while others may benefit from longer-term care.
Is everything discussed confidential?
Yes. Psychiatrists follow strict ethical and legal standards regarding patient confidentiality, with limited exceptions related to immediate safety concerns.
